AMAZING STORY! Jewish Couple Saved From Las Vegas Massacre With Incredible Hashgacha Pratis


Nothing less than Hashgacha Pratis is how this amazing story can be described.

A Jewish couple that lives in Las Vegas had tickets to the concert where the horrific mass shooting took place last night. At the last minute they cancelled their plans and did not attend.

A community member has informed YWN, that the woman, who is a teacher at the Yeshiva Day School of Las Vegas, and her husband, attended Davening at a local Shul for Yom Kippur. The husband only stayed for Kol Nidrei, but was inspired to fast the entire Yom Kippur. His wife returned to Shul for davening during the day, and had an “Aliya Ruchni” from the experience.

On Sunday afternoon, the husband came down with a severe headache, while the wife decided she didn’t want to attend the non-Jewish concert just one day after Yom Kippur.

Thus, the couple decided to cancel their plans, and the rest of the story is history.

The massacre left at least 58 people dead, and more than 500 people injured.
